Correct Answer:

Primary prevention
The elimination of the onset and development of a communication disorder by altering susceptibility or environment for susceptible persons.
Secondary prevention
The early detection and treatment of communication disorders.
Handicap
The social disadvantage that an individual experiences because of an impairment and resulting disability.
Tertiary prevention
The reduction of a disability by attempting to restore effective functioning.
Disability
An individual’s reduced ability to meet the needs of daily living; determined by the severity of the impairment, the person’s lifestyle, or the extent to which the individual can compensate.
Impairment
Any loss or abnormality of psychological, physiological, or anatomical structure or function.
At risk
The potential to develop a disorder based on specific biological, environmental, or behavioral factors.
